One of the more popular websites offering software-training is Atomic Learning. Atomic Learning offers people training and a set of courses on web-based software. With their approach of answering the common questions people have when learning various computer programs, Atomic Learning has the educational tools that makes them an effective source for those wanting to gain computer skills.
Along with a library of
computer-related courses available to those wanting to
learn some new computer skills (such as Photoshop 6, Final
Cut Pro, and Windows XP), what makes Atomic Learning a
notable learning resource is probably the numerous,
straightforward tutorial
movies they offer on various computer programs.
Atomic Learning offers over 20,000 tutorial movies on a
variety of computer programs. For the people’s
convenience, these videos can be viewed by the most
common software applications. In addition, over 500 new
tutorials are added every 45 days.
